PHASE ADJUSTMENT FOR MULTIPLE
ARC SYSTEMS
Phase
• The phase relationship between the arcs helps to
minimize the magnetic interaction between adjacent
arcs. It is essentially a time offset between the
waveforms of different arcs, and is set in terms of an
angle from 0 to 360°, representing no offset to a full
period offset. The offset of each arc is set
independently with respect to the lead arc of the
system (ARC 1).
Recommendations:
• For balanced waveforms a phase relationship of 90°
should be maintained between adjacent arcs.
• For unbalanced waveforms:
– Avoid switching at same time.
– Break up long periods of unchanged polarity
relative to adjacent arcs.
